NBA PPG AVG

2000----------94.8
2005----------97.0
2010----------99.6
2015---------102.7
2016---------105.6
2017---------106.3
2018---------111.2
2019---------111.8
2020-21----113.6 (19 games)

The emphasis on scoring at the expense of defense makes the game less interesting imo. Its probably a generational thing.
TBF, there were also high PPG numbers pre-1995.

It goes in cycles. Pre-1980, the NBA was essentially little more than a barnstorming league. There was a lot of emphasis on individual play.

In the 80's the game became much more team oriented with a lot of ball movement and scoring. But there was also still some pretty physical defense played. The Bad Boy Pistons took the physicality to a higher level and the 90's and 00's were extremely physical to the point where it sometimes barely resembled basketball.

In the early 00's the league started moving away from the physicality of the 90's by changing some of the rules, but they've gone too far, imo. They need to get back to a mix similar to the 80's when there was plenty of scoring, but also some physical defense being played as well.
